BLACK WALNUT CAKE



Black Walnut Cake image

I got this recipe from an old Army mess hall sergeant who later became a chef down in Savannah, GA. This is a wonderful, different nut cake. It is equally good served warm or cold. This cake can be wrapped and frozen 3 to 5 months. Thaw, and if desired, reheat to serve.

Provided by Patricia Canerdy

Categories     Desserts     Nut Dessert Recipes     Walnut Dessert Recipes

Time 1h55m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up butter, softened
½ cup shortening
3 cups sugar
5 eggs
3 cups all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 cup milk
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
½ cup chopped black wal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Grease and flour a 10 inch tube pan.
  • In a large bowl, cream together the butter, shortening, and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s one at a time, mixing just until the yellow disappears. Combine the flour, baking powder, and cinnamon; stir into the creamed mixture alternately with the milk. Stir in the vanilla and walnuts, and pour into the prepared pan.
  • Bake for 1 hour and 30 minutes, or until a knife or toothpick inserted into the crown comes out clean. Cool in the pan for about 15 minutes before turning out of the pan onto a wire rack to cool completely.

HEDY'S (CHOCOLATE) BLACK WALNUT CAKE



Hedy's (Chocolate) Black Walnut Cake image

Make and share this Hedy's (Chocolate) Black Walnut Cake rec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Michele7

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h35m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 1/2 cups chopped black walnuts or 1 1/2 cups english walnuts, toasted
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 3/4 cups granulated sugar
1 1/2 cups butter, melted
1 cup packed dark brown sugar
5 eggs
2 tablespoons rum or 2 tablespoons milk
1/2 teaspoon vanilla
2 2/3 cups all-purpose flour
3/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der or 3/4 cup carob powder
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up milk
1 1/3 cups sifted powdered sugar (optional)
2 tablespoons butter, melted (optional)
1 tablespoon rum or 1 tablespoon milk (optional)
1 tablespoon whipping cream or 1 tablespoon milk (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325.
  • Grease and flour a 10-inch square pan or a 10-inch fluted tube pan; set aside.
  • In a small bowl stir together the nuts and 2 T flour, set aside.
  • In a very large bowl stir granulated sugar, butter, and brown sugar until combined.
  • Using a wooden spoon, beat in eggs one at a time.
  • Stir in the 2 T rum or milk and vanilla.
  • In a medium bowl stir together the flour, the chocolate or carob powder, baking powder, and salt.
  • Stir flour mixture into egg mixture with a wooden spoon.
  • Gradually stir in milk.
  • Fold in the nut mixture.
  • Pour batter into the prepared pan.
  • Bake for 65 minutes or until toothpick inserted near center comes out clean.
  • Let cool in pan on a wire rack for 10 minutes.
  • Remove from pan.
  • Let stand for 1 hour.
  • Drizzle with Glaze, if desired.
  • Cool completely.
  • To make Glaze: In a small bowl combine 1 1/3 C sifted powdered sugar; 2 T butter, melted; and 1 T rum or milk.
  • Next, stir in 1 T whipping cream or milk.
  • If necessary, add additional milk or cream, 1 t at a time, until it reaches drizzling consistency.

BLACK WALNUT CAKE



Black Walnut Cake image

My mother's family members all were excellent cooks and known for their great hospitality. A longtime family favorite, this old-fashioned cake was always expected at holiday dinners, special occasions and potlucks.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h20m

Yield 16 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 cup chopped black or English walnuts
3 cups all-purpose flour, divided
1 cup butter, softened
2 cups sugar
4 large e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up whole milk
FROSTING:
1-3/4 cups sugar
4 large egg whites
1/2 cup water
1/2 teaspoon cream of tartar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• In a bowl, toss walnuts with 1/4 cup flour; set aside. In a bowl, cream butter and sugar.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Add vanilla; mix well., Combine the baking powder, salt and remaining flour; add to the creamed mixture alternately with milk. Stir in the reserved nut mixture., Transfer to a greased and floured 10-in. tube pan. Bake at 350° for 50-55 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ack to cool completely., In a heavy saucepan, combine sugar, egg whites, water and cream of tartar. With a portable mixer, beat on low speed for 1 minute. Continue beating on low speed over low heat until frosting reaches 160°, about 9 minutes., Pour into the bowl of a heavy-duty stand mixer; add vanilla. Beat on high speed until frosting forms stiff peaks, about 7 minutes. Frost the cake.
